Hargreaves: History of tendinitis
Owen Hargreaves made his long-awaited return to action in a Manchester United reserves game against Burnley.
The midfielder has not played a first-team game since featuring against Chelsea at Stamford Bridge in September 2008 through problems with tendinitis in both knees.
However, a 45-minute outing for the reserves against Burnley at Altrincham on Thursday is a step in the right direction for the Canadian-born former Bayern Munich player.
Hargreaves was reluctant to reach fifth gear in the match but came through a half unscathed with few tough tackles from the opposition.
United paid Bayern £17million for his services in 2007, but injuries have limited the one-time England international to just 37 competitive appearances for the club.
